On the other hand, and leaving aside the story; diets Montignac says that a good and balanced combination of foods directly contributes to reducing the weight, because according to Dr. Montignac, foods are divided into three main groups of proteins, carbohydrates and lipids, which in turn are divided into good and bad, which when combined in the exact amounts can generate impressive salutary effects on metabolism without affecting the dietary intake.
The application and / or development of the Montignac diet is divided in two main phases, the first stage is one where strict food must be done to the letter from the diet, however it is good to mention that this step or phase also is the most efficient, because the results can range from one kilo per week for the front. On the other hand, the second phase is that of maintenance, where even when the power must remain the same, this can now be more flexible and add some elements in small quantities.
